I've got 2 of the rockford fostgate stage 3 4-ohm 500 watts rms subs and I was wonderin what amp would power them the best?I've heard mono amps are good for 2 if you use both subs on the same channel but I'm not 100% sure

I'll start by giving you your options.

Your subs are dual 4ohm, 500w rms. A pretty good start....

If you go with a mono channel amp, you will wire the subs up in a 1, 4, or 16 ohm load. Obviously, you dont want a 16 ohm load, so 4 or 1 is the way to go here. Pretty much any amp will carry a 4 ohm load with no problems. If you go 1 ohm, make sure you get an amp that is 1 ohm stable (harder to find and more expensive).

Option 2, the way I would go for your subs, is a nice 2 channel amp that is 2 ohm stereo stable. Wire each sub to 2 ohms, on each channel. Efficient, easy to find and can be inexspensive.

I would look for an amp that is around 800-1000w rms and a decent brand. Every person will tell you a differnet brand to buy, but just use the internet to look up reviews and make an educated decision that you will be happy with.
